Skip to content

How to Create an Effective SaaS Affiliate Marketing Program

    How to Create an Effective SaaS Affiliate Marketing Program

    When it comes to marketing your SaaS business, affiliate marketing can be a powerful strategy for driving leads and sales. SaaS affiliate marketing involves partnering with third-party affiliates to promote your affiliate product or service in exchange for a commission.

    The benefits of SaaS affiliate marketing are numerous, including increased brand exposure, expanded customer reach, and the ability to drive more sales without additional marketing spend.

    However, in order to reap the benefits of affiliate marketing, it’s essential to create an effective affiliate marketing program that aligns with your business objectives and provides the right incentives and support for your affiliates.

    In this comprehensive SaaS affiliate marketing guide, we’ll explore the key steps involved in creating an effective SaaS affiliate marketing program, from defining your objectives to recruiting quality affiliates, providing effective support, and tracking and measuring your results.

    SaaS Affiliate Marketing Stats Trends ROI

    By following these steps and implementing best practices, you can create a successful affiliate marketing program that drives meaningful results for your SaaS business.

    1. Define Your SaaS Affiliate Program Objectives

    Before you start creating your SaaS affiliate marketing program, it’s important to define your objectives. Defining your objectives helps you determine what you hope to achieve with your program and provides a clear framework for measuring its success.

    There are a variety of objectives you might consider for your SaaS affiliate marketing program, depending on your business goals and marketing priorities. Some common objectives might include:

    Increasing Leads:

    If your primary goal is to generate more leads for your SaaS product or service, you might focus on recruiting affiliates who specialize in lead generation and offer commission structures that incentivize them to drive high-quality leads to your website.

    Driving Sales:

    If your main objective is to increase sales, you might offer commission structures that reward affiliates for converting leads into paying customers. You might also consider partnering with affiliates with strong sales skills or a proven track record of driving sales for similar products.

    Increasing Brand Awareness:

    If your goal is to increase brand exposure and visibility, you might focus on recruiting affiliates who have a large following or a strong social media presence. You might also consider offering incentives for affiliates who create content that promotes your brand or product.

    Expanding Your Customer Base:

    If you’re looking to expand your customer base, you might focus on recruiting affiliates who specialize in targeting specific customer demographics or niches. You might also consider offering personalized support or incentives for affiliates who are able to drive new customers to your product or service.

    SaaS Affiliate Marketing Channels

    By defining your objectives upfront, you can tailor your affiliate marketing program to achieve the specific outcomes you’re looking for. This can help you attract the right affiliates, create effective commission structures and incentives, and ultimately drive more leads and sales for your SaaS business.

    2. Determine Your Commission and Incentive Structure

    Once you’ve defined your objectives, the next step in creating an effective SaaS affiliate marketing program is to determine your commission and incentive structure. Your commission and incentive structure will dictate how affiliates are compensated for promoting your affiliate product or service.

    There are several different commission and incentive structures you might consider for your SaaS affiliate marketing program, depending on your goals and the nature of your product or service. Some common structures include:


    This structure pays affiliates a percentage of the sale price for each successful purchase made through their affiliate link. This is a common structure for SaaS products with a higher price point.


    This structure pays affiliates a fixed amount for each successful lead generated through their affiliate link. This can be a good structure for SaaS businesses looking to generate a large number of leads quickly.

    Recurring commissions:

    This structure pays affiliates a percentage of the recurring revenue generated by customers they referred to your SaaS product or service. This can be a good structure for SaaS businesses with a subscription-based model.

    It’s important to choose a commission and incentive structure that aligns with your objectives and provides sufficient motivation for your affiliates to promote your product or service.

    SaaS Affiliate Marketing Payment Models

    Some successful commission and incentive structures used by other SaaS businesses include:

    • HubSpot’s partner program offers a tiered commission structure, with higher commission rates and additional incentives for partners who achieve certain performance metrics or milestones.
    • Zoom’s affiliate program offers a pay-per-sale commission structure, with higher commission rates for affiliates who generate more sales each month.
    • Canva’s affiliate program offers a combination of commission and incentives, including a pay-per-sale commission structure and additional incentives for affiliates who generate a certain number of sales or drive traffic to specific landing pages.

    By choosing the right commission and incentive structure for your SaaS affiliate marketing program, you can motivate and incentivize your affiliates to promote your product or service effectively, driving more leads and sales for your business.

    3. Find and Recruit Quality SaaS Affiliates

    Now that you have defined your objectives and commission structure, the next step is to find and recruit quality affiliates for your SaaS affiliate marketing program. Here are some tips to help you get started:

    Leverage your existing customer base:

    One of the best sources of quality affiliates for your SaaS business can be your existing customer base. Consider reaching out to your satisfied customers and offering them the opportunity to become affiliates or provide them with promotional materials and incentivize them to share with their networks.

    Use affiliate networks:

    Affiliate networks can be a great way to connect with a large pool of potential affiliates. These networks typically provide tools and resources to help you manage your program and recruit new affiliates.

    Attend industry events:

    Attending industry events and conferences can be a great way to connect with potential affiliates face-to-face. These events can also provide valuable networking opportunities and insights into industry trends.

    When recruiting affiliates, it’s important to vet them to ensure they align with your brand and values. Here are some key factors to consider:

    • Relevance: Look for affiliates who have a strong connection to your target audience or who operate in a related industry or niche.
    • Quality: Prioritize affiliates with a strong track record of generating leads or sales for similar products or services.
    • Ethics: Ensure that your affiliates are ethical and follow industry best practices, such as disclosing their affiliate relationship with your business to their audiences.

    By finding and recruiting quality affiliates who align with your brand and values, you can build a network of trusted partners who can help you achieve your marketing objectives and drive growth for your SaaS business.

    AI Tools for Business Growth

    4. Provide Effective Affiliate Support

    Once you’ve recruited quality affiliates for your SaaS affiliate marketing program, the next step is to provide them with effective support. Providing effective support can help your affiliates feel valued, motivated, and equipped to promote your product or service effectively.

    Here are some tips to help you provide effective affiliate support:

    Offer training:

    Providing training and resources to your affiliates can help them understand your product or service better and feel confident in promoting it. Consider creating an onboarding program or hosting webinars or training sessions to help your affiliates get up to speed.

    Provide marketing materials:

    Offering high-quality marketing materials, such as banners, emails, landing pages, and social media posts, can help your affiliates promote your product or service more effectively. Be sure to provide clear instructions and guidelines for how these materials can be used to avoid any confusion.

    Foster ongoing communication:

    Regularly communicating with your affiliates can help you stay connected and ensure that they have the support they need to succeed. Consider creating a private forum or group where affiliates can share ideas, ask questions, and get support from you and other affiliates.

    In addition to these general support strategies, offering personalized support and incentives can also motivate your affiliates to promote your SaaS product or service more effectively. Some examples of personalized support and incentives include:

    • Personalized coaching or support: Offering personalized coaching or support can help your affiliates feel valued and motivated to promote your product or service. Consider offering individualized support or coaching sessions to help your top affiliates maximize their performance.
    • Performance-based incentives: Offering performance-based incentives, such as bonuses or special rewards for affiliates who achieve certain goals or milestones, can motivate your affiliates to work harder and generate more leads or sales for your business.

    By providing effective affiliate support, you can help your affiliates feel valued, motivated, and equipped to promote your SaaS product or service effectively, driving more leads and sales for your business.

    Chatbot Marketing - Strategy and Examples for Digital Success

    5. Track and Measure Results

    Tracking and measuring results is crucial to determine the effectiveness of your affiliate program and identify areas for improvement. Here’s what you need to know about tracking and measuring results:

    Importance of tracking:

    Tracking and measuring results can help you calculate the ROI of your affiliate program, identify your top-performing affiliates, and adjust your strategy as needed.

    Tracking and measurement tools:

    There are several tracking and measurement tools you can use to monitor your program’s performance, such as Google Analytics, affiliate tracking software, and conversion tracking tools. These tools can help you track metrics such as clicks, leads, and conversions.

    Metrics to track:

    Some of the most important metrics to track include the number of affiliates, the number of clicks, the conversion rate, and the revenue generated. By tracking these metrics, you can gain valuable insights into the effectiveness of your program and identify areas for improvement.

    Strategies for improving results:

    Once you’ve tracked and measured your results, you can use this data to adjust your program and improve your results. Some strategies for improving your results might include optimizing your landing pages, offering higher commissions or bonuses to top-performing affiliates, or providing additional support or resources to underperforming affiliates.

    By tracking and measuring your results, you can gain valuable insights into the effectiveness of your affiliate program and identify areas for improvement. Be sure to use tracking and measurement tools and strategies to monitor your program’s performance, track important metrics, and adjust your affiliate program marketing strategy as needed to achieve your marketing objectives and drive growth for your SaaS business.

    Social Media Advertising Campaign ROI Calculator

    6. Optimize Your SaaS Affiliate Program

    Ongoing optimization is critical to ensure that your affiliate program is performing at its best. Here are some practical tips to optimize your affiliate program:

    Test commission rates:

    Experiment with different commission rates to determine which rates work best for your program. For example, you might offer a higher commission for top-performing affiliates or increase commissions during peak sales periods.

    Refine affiliate support:

    Continuously refine your affiliate support to provide affiliates with the tools and resources they need to succeed. This might include offering new marketing materials, providing personalized support, or offering training sessions to help affiliates improve their performance.

    Identify top-performing affiliates:

    Use your tracking and measurement tools to identify your top-performing affiliates, and then work to strengthen those relationships. Consider offering bonuses or other incentives to reward their performance and encourage them to continue promoting your product or service.

    Monitor feedback:

    Monitor feedback from your affiliates to identify areas for improvement. This might include conducting surveys or hosting focus groups to gather feedback on your program’s commission structure, support, or overall effectiveness.

    By continually optimizing your affiliate program, you can ensure that it is performing at its best and driving growth for your SaaS business. Use these practical tips to refine your commission and incentive structure, effectively support your affiliates, and identify top-performing partners to achieve your marketing objectives and drive success for your business.

    30 Marketing Intelligence Tools for Data-Driven Marketing

    Final Thoughts

    In conclusion, creating an effective SaaS affiliate marketing program is a valuable investment that can help you achieve your marketing objectives and drive success for your business.

    By taking the time to create a thoughtful and well-executed program, you can leverage the power of affiliate marketing to reach new audiences, drive leads and sales, and build a thriving SaaS business.

    Remember, the key to success with an affiliate program is to provide quality support and resources to your affiliates and to continually refine and optimize your program based on the results you achieve. By doing so, you can build a strong network of affiliates who will promote your product or service to their own audiences, driving growth and success for your SaaS business.